Big Medicine Hot Springs flows from geothermal sources in Meagher County, Montana, at around 50°C. The spring is part of the broader thermal field that underlies the White Sulphur Springs area and which supported multiple bathhouse operations in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. The site combines historical significance with natural beauty in the wide Smith River valley, where the Crazy Mountains rise to the north and the Elkhorn Range frames the south.
